AWS IP Address Ranges

Amazon Web Services (AWS) publishes its current IP address ranges in JSON format. To view the current ranges, download the .json file. To maintain history, save successive versions of the .json file on your system. To determine whether there have been changes since the last time that you saved the file, check the publication time in the current file and compare it to the publication time in the last file that you saved.

If you access this file programmatically, it is your responsibility to ensure that the application downloads the file only after successfully verifying the TLS certificate presented by the server.

Syntax

The syntax of ip-ranges.json is as follows.

{
  "syncToken": "0123456789",
  "createDate": "yyyy-mm-dd-hh-mm-ss",
  "prefixes": [
    {
      "ip_prefix": "cidr",
      "region": "region",
      "service": "subset"
    }
  ]
}
syncToken

The publication time, in Unix epoch time format.

Type: String

Example: "syncToken": "1416435608"

createDate

The publication date and time.

Type: String

Example: "createDate": "2014-11-19-23-29-02"

prefixes

The IP prefixes.

Type: Array

ip_prefix

The public IP address range, in CIDR notation.

Type: String

Example: "ip_prefix": "198.51.100.2/24"

region

The AWS region or GLOBAL for edge locations. Note that the CLOUDFRONT and ROUTE53 ranges are GLOBAL.

Type: String

Valid values: ap-northeast-1 | ap-southeast-1 | ap-southeast-2 | cn-north-1 | eu-central-1 | eu-west-1 | sa-east-1 | us-east-1 | us-gov-west-1 | us-west-1 | us-west-2 | GLOBAL

Example: "region": "us-east-1"

service

The subset of IP address ranges. Specify AMAZON to get all IP address ranges (for example, the ranges in the EC2 subset are also in the AMAZON subset). Note that some IP address ranges are only in the AMAZON subset.

Type: String

Valid values: AMAZON | EC2 | CLOUDFRONT | ROUTE53 | ROUTE53_HEALTHCHECKS

Example: "service": "AMAZON"
